Call for consultants- Home-Based Expert in Gender Violence Prevention(Remote)

Admin, February 1, 2025February 1, 2025

Application Deadline: February 7,2025

UN Women is actively seeking a qualified consultant to develop a comprehensive strategy for preventing violence against women (VAW). This exciting home-based opportunity is ideal for experts in gender equality, human rights, and policy advocacy who are looking to make a lasting impact on the fight against gender-based violence. The consultant will analyze global prevention efforts, assess UN Women’s contributions, and propose actionable steps for the next 4-5 years. Applications are open until February 7, 2025.

Why This Role Matters

Violence against women and girls (VAWG) remains a critical global issue. It limits women’s choices, threatens their safety, and hinders progress toward gender equality. UN Women has been at the forefront of efforts to eliminate gender-based violence, working to ensure safer public and private spaces and increasing access to survivor support services.

This consultancy will contribute to a forward-looking prevention strategy that strengthens UN Women’s initiatives and aligns with the latest global approaches. The selected consultant will provide fresh insights and practical recommendations to enhance prevention programming worldwide.

Key Responsibilities

The consultant will work closely with UN Women’s Ending Violence Against Women (EVAW) section. The main responsibilities include:

  • Research and Analysis (Due: April 15, 2025): Compile a synthesis report outlining key trends, challenges, gaps, and opportunities in VAW prevention.
  • Strategy Development (Due: May 10, 2025): Draft a comprehensive prevention strategy with a clear vision, objectives, and actions for the next 4-5 years.
  • Final Strategy Report (Due: May 30, 2025): Refine the strategy based on stakeholder feedback, ensuring a coherent and actionable framework.

All deliverables will be provided in English and submitted electronically.

Who Should Apply?

This role is designed for professionals with a strong background in gender studies, policy advocacy, and violence prevention. Ideal candidates will have:

  • Education: A Master’s degree in social sciences, gender studies, international development, or human rights (PhD preferred but not required).
  • Experience: At least 10 years of expertise in designing, planning, implementing, and evaluating VAW prevention programs at the international level.
  • Skills: Exceptional writing, research, and communication skills, along with knowledge of evidence-based prevention approaches.
  • Language Proficiency: Fluency in English is essential.

Contract Details

  • Duration: February 15 – May 30, 2025
  • Location: Home-based (No travel required)
  • Application Deadline: February 7, 2025
